Typing Shooter Game — Destroy Enemies by Typing Words
A typing shooter game is exactly what it sounds like: a shooter where your keyboard is the weapon. Enemies appear. Each carries a word. Type the word to fire and destroy the enemy before it reaches you.
It sounds simple. It becomes intense fast.

What Makes a Great Typing Shooter Game?
The best typing shooters share three mechanics:
Lock-on targeting — you type the first letter to choose which enemy to engage. This adds a strategic layer: which target is the biggest threat? Which word can you type fastest? Good typing shooters make that choice meaningful.
Escalating difficulty — wave-based survival with increasing speed, more enemies, and harder vocabulary. The game should push your current ceiling, not stay comfortable.
High-stakes failure — missing too many enemies ends the run. That pressure is the training mechanism. Without stakes, it's just a typing test with graphics.

How Space Typer Works as a Typing Shooter
Each enemy ship in Space Typer carries a word target. The combat flow:
- Scan — identify which enemy is the highest threat (closest to your position)
- Lock on — type the first letter of its word to auto-target
- Destroy — complete the word to fire and eliminate the enemy
- Repeat — engage the next priority target before it advances
- Boss wave — every 5 levels, a boss appears with a longer, harder word
As waves increase:
- More enemies appear simultaneously
- Enemies advance faster
- Words get longer and less common
- Boss words become significantly harder
This creates genuine progression difficulty — not artificial time limits, but actual increases in cognitive demand.

Combat Tactics: How to Survive Higher Waves
Priority system: Always engage the enemy closest to your position first. Ignore the tempting high-value targets at the top of the screen. The enemy that reaches you ends the wave.
Short words first in crowds: When five enemies appear simultaneously, destroy the ones with the shortest words first to reduce target count quickly.
Lock on immediately: Don't think — the moment you finish one word, your first keystroke should be the opening letter of the next target. No pause between enemies.
Boss rule: Stop. Read the boss word fully. Then type it cleanly. Rushing a 12-character boss word results in errors that cost more time than a clean read-first approach.
Recognise your weak letters: After several sessions, you'll notice specific letters that cause you to hesitate. Run typing lessons on those specific keys between sessions.

How is a typing shooter different from a typing test? A typing test measures your existing speed under neutral conditions. A typing shooter game trains your speed under pressure — the condition that actually matters for real-world performance.
